Decision-making Method for Fire and Electronic Warfare Based on Rough-group Under Incomplete Information
In order to solve the synthesized fire and electronic warfare decision-making problem for the aircraft, for the incomplete of battlefield information, the rough-group decision-making system for fire and electronic warfare under incomplete information is defined. The algorithm process is given too. The optimal selection of the decision-making information system is put forward according to the principle to make the decision have the maximum probability and then the decision-making rule is extracted from the optimal selection. Based on the exertion principle of fire and electronic warfare, the simulation is validated under the battle condition and the result shows that the application of rough-group method of fire and electronic warfare for the new generation aircraft is feasible and effective.
